T-Mobile
Account Executive, Business Sales Tampa St Petersburgh FL
T-Mobile, St. Petersburg, Florida, United States, 33739
Job Overview
At T‑Mobile, we invest in YOU! Every team member receives a competitive base salary and total rewards package that includes annual stock grant, employee stock purchase plan, 401(k), and access to free, year‑round money coaches. This is how we’re UNSTOPPABLE for our employees.
Responsibilities
Lead Generation: Prospect, cold‑call, and network to generate leads under sales manager supervision.
Customer Needs: Identify needs and use solution‑based selling to demonstrate T‑Mobile’s value. Recommend wireless solutions, including plans, data, handsets, and accessories.
Deal Negotiation: Negotiate and close deals.
Skill Development: Develop prospecting, call execution, and relationship management skills; participate in product training and sales meetings.
Sales Automation: Utilize sales force automation, manage sales funnel, and report on activities and forecasts.
Customer Base: Maintain and grow the customer base within a territory model.
Education & Work Experience
High School Diploma/GED (Required)
Bachelor’s Degree (Preferred)
1+ years verifiable new customer acquisition sales experience, preferably in a commissioned environment (Preferred)
Outside B2B sales experience (Preferred)
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
Task Management: Work well in a dynamic, fast‑changing environment that requires multitasking (Required)
Customer Service: Deliver superior service and attention to detail (Required)
Communication: Excellent interpersonal, written, and oral communication skills (Required)
Negotiation: Effective negotiating and closing skills, including emotional intelligence and problem‑solving (Required)
Licenses & Certifications
At least 18 years of age (Required)
Legally authorized to work in the United States (Required)
Travel Travel Required: Yes
Compensation Total Target Cash Pay Range: $71,700 – $129,500 (inclusive of target incentives)
Base Pay Range: $43,020 – $77,700
Benefits Full and part‑time employees have access to the same benefits when eligible. Benefits include medical, dental, and vision insurance, a flexible spending account, 401(k), employee stock grants, employee stock purchase plan, paid time off, up to 12 paid holidays, paid parental and family leave, family building benefits, backup care, enhanced family support, childcare subsidy, tuition assistance, college coaching, short‑ and long‑term disability, voluntary AD&D coverage, and more.
